Title :
Modified Optimized Link State Routing (M-OLSR) for Wireless Mesh Networks

Abstract :
Wireless mesh networks (WMNs) are a type of radio-based network systems which require minimal configuration and infrastructure. One of the factors that influence the performance of WMNs is the underlying routing protocol used. Here, we propose one such routing protocol, called M-OLSR, which is a variant of OLSR, a traditional link-state protocol developed to meet the requirements of mobile adhoc networks MANETs. Our approach improves the throughput and packet delivery ratio, while minimizing routing overhead and delay, by choosing a stable path for packet forwarding through static routers. Simulation results demonstrate that, for WMNs, the M-OLSR outperforms OLSR in terms of throughput, packet delivery ratio, and routing overhead.
